Introduction
This course has been approved by the Royal Society of Chemistry (RSC) for purposes of Continuing Professional Development (CPD). 

This module covers the various Sample Introduction techniques in detail, including their theory, parameters and applications. These include on-column injections, split injections, splitless injections and types of large volume injection techniques.

As the inlet is the most common area for problems within a GC(-MS) system, your troubleshooting and maintenance skills will greatly benefit from having a thorough knowledge of inlet systems and how they work.

The module concludes with a questions and answers session.

This 4-hour module is taught live in a virtual classroom, is totally interactive with instrument parts and consumables shown & explained. There are small group sizes so plenty of opportunities to ask questions then get them answered on screen.
